The SBG01 is a water cooled high-intensity heat flux sensor (according to Schmidt-Boelter), intended for fire/flame measurement applications (e.g. flammability and smoke chamber testing). The SBG01 is compliant with ASTM E 622-83, ISO 5658, 5560 and 17554 measurement standards.


Engineered for fire and flame heat flux measurement research, the SBG01 is intended for high-intensity flux measurement applications. The SBG01 is suitable for use in applications dominated by thermal radiation. For applications environments with significant convection effects, additional considerations should be taken. Employing entirely passive thermopile-based sensing technology, the SBG01 generates an output voltage signal that is proportional to the incoming heat flux received at the sensor detector level. The sensor housing is water cooled, providing a stable operational case temperature under high-intensity flux conditions up to 200 kW/m2. The SBG01 range consists of six (6) different SBG01 models; model selection depends on required sensitivity, response time and expected maximum intensity range (5, 10, 20, 50, 100 and 200 kW/m2 maximum). SBG01 Specifications
ISO Classification: Second Class
Temperature range, cooling water: 10 to + 30°C
Cooling water flow: > 10 L/hr (normal tap water)
30 L p/hr @ 3 bar recommended
Working ranges kW/m2: 5,10,20,50,100,200
Response times
Working range 5, 10 kW/m2: < 450 ms (63%)
Working range 20, 50 kW/m2: < 250 ms (63%)
Working range 100, 200 kW/m2: < 200 ms (63%)
Maximum range: 150% of working range
Output signal: > 5 mV at working range
Spectral range: to 50µm
Field of view: 180 degrees
Emissivity: > 0.95
Calibration traceability: NIST
